What Is Windows Hello Face Authentication (WHFA) ?
Windows Hello is a biometric authentication technology built into Windows devices that allows users to securely sign in using facial recognition, fingerprints, or a PIN instead of traditional passwords.
For facial recognition, Windows Hello relies on specialized hardware such as:
- RGB Camera
- Infrared (IR) Camera
- IR Illumination System
- Face Detection Algorithms
These components work together to verify a user’s identity quickly and securely.
Because authentication accuracy and security are critical, Microsoft defines strict requirements for image quality, face detection reliability, and low-light performance.

Image Quality Testing
Camera image quality directly impacts facial recognition performance.
Typical evaluation includes:
- Signal-to-Noise Ratio (SNR)
- Modulation Transfer Function (MTF)
- Relative Illumination
- Gamma and contrast evaluation
- Texture and sharpness analysis
- Blemish detection
These tests ensure consistent image performance across the full field of view.
Face Detection Performance
Face detection testing validates the system’s ability to reliably detect and track human faces.
Testing includes:
- Face detection accuracy
- Detection stability across distances
- Face-based auto exposure performance
- RGB and IR face detection capability
Low-Light Performance Testing
Windows Hello relies heavily on infrared imaging for secure authentication.
Low-light validation includes:
- IR illumination performance
- Infrared image response
- Face recognition under dark environments
- RGB + IR concurrent operation
These tests ensure authentication works reliably even in dim lighting conditions.
Optical and Camera Validation
Camera optical characteristics are also evaluated to ensure reliable recognition.
Testing may include:
- Field of View (FOV) verification
- Face capture distance
- ROI (Region of Interest) image quality
